Associer Aux Programmations Électroniques Les Subtilités De La Musique Modale Et Ses Irréductibles Quarts De Tons.-- More Of An Infusion Than A Fusion Egyptian Project Is The Result Of A Long And Committed Collaboration Between The Defenders Of Egyptian Tradition And A Young French Musician Who Mix The Sounds Of The Nile Delta And Cairo With The Ambiances Of Trip-Hop Electro Hip-Hop And Even Classical Music. “The Fluvial Meeting Of Oriental Fragrances And Minimalist Electronic Sounds” Makes For A Journey Into Unexplored Territories. One Can Only Dream Of Distant Times When Musicians Dancers And All Different Kinds Of Artists Lingered In The Neighborhoods And Cafés Of Cairo Awaiting Nightly Propositions To Perform At Parties Weddings Or Child Births. Its An Electronic-Acoustic Vibe That Reveals And Awakens The Beauty Of The Music Of The Nile Riverbanks And Carries Listeners To Far And Distant Lands. It's The Undertaking Of Jérôme Ettinger A Musician Without Borders And The Art Director Of The Project Lead By The Association Togezer. For Over 10 Years He Multiplied The Number Of Musical Experiments Artists Residencies And Meetings In France And In Egypt And Organized Many Educational Activities Around Traditional Egyptian Instruments Rababa Percussion Violin Singing And Kawala And Computer Made Music.
Jérôme While Immersing Himself In The Egyptian Culture Was Fostered By Jean Paul Romann A Sound Engineer For Tinariwen Lojo... During A Pre-Production And Recording Session. Rodolphe Gervais A Sound Engineer For Ray Charles Assassin Idir... Later Took Up The Recording And Mixing Of The Album At Studio Du Faune. One Can Only Imagine The Difficulty Conjoining Sequencers With The Maqsoum Baladi Or Ayoub Rhythms Of The Master Percussionist Ragab Sadek Conciliating The Incredible Outpourings Of Singer And Kawala Player Sayed Eman With The Contemporary Vocal Work Of Jérôme Ettinger Tuning The Notes Of The Famous Rababa Player And Violinist Salama Metwally With A Computer And Associating Electronic Programming With The Subtlety Of Modal Music And Its Relentless Quarter Tones. “Patience Is A Beautiful Thing” As They Say In Egypt. And Jérôme Ettinger Took His Time. Himself Being An Argûl Player A Rare Egyptian Double Clarinet He Learned To Play With The Famous Mostafa Abdel Aziz Musiciens Du Nil Mozart L’égyptien Peter Gabriel... . Accompanied From The Start By His Friend Ihab Radwan An Oud Player Who Worked With Hugues De Courson On Mozart L'égyptien Jérôme Ettinger Keeps His Project Alive Both On Stage And On The Album Where We Find The Participation Of The Oud Player. The Project Is Destined To Evolve With A Feminine Voice From Cairo As Well As Other Musicians Met Along The Way.--
